Quote: EvenBobMy Comcast tests at 30 every time. My connectivity
is instantaneous, I don't see how having 100 would
improve it. Instant is instant.
You're confusing latency and bandwidth.
30 is more than enough to stream high-def video though, or even the "super-high-def" that Netflix and Amazon Video offer. Higher can be useful if you have several people in the household streaming at once, or if you're downloading very large files. For me the only time it's relevant is if I'm downloading a large game from PSN. It might be several gigs, so higher bandwidth means I don't have to wait as long.
